What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Dashboard Developer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Dashboard Developer,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in data visualization, and a solid understanding of database management, typically backed by a degree in computer science, information systems, or a related field. Expertise in tools like Tableau, Power BI, SQL, and knowledge of front-end development frameworks or relevant certifications are highly valued. Effective communication, attention to detail, and the ability to translate business needs into actionable insights are key soft skills for this position. These competencies ensure that dashboard solutions are accurate, user-friendly, and aligned with organizational goals, supporting data-driven decision-making.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Dashboard Developer?

A Dashboard Developer's daily responsibilities often include gathering data requirements from stakeholders, designing and developing interactive dashboards, and ensuring data accuracy and integrity. You will regularly work with business intelligence tools and database systems to extract, transform, and visualize data, making it accessible and understandable for end users. Collaboration with analysts, business managers, and IT teams is common to refine dashboard features and troubleshoot any issues that arise. Staying updated on industry best practices and continuously optimizing dashboard performance are also important aspects of the role.

What is a Dashboard Developer job?

A Dashboard Developer is responsible for designing, building, and maintaining data-driven dashboards that help organizations visualize key metrics and insights. They work with business stakeholders to understand requirements, extract data from various sources, and use tools like Power BI, Tableau, or Looker to create interactive reports. Strong skills in data analysis, SQL, and dashboard design are essential. Their goal is to present complex data in a clear and actionable way to support decision-making.
